Have you seen the 1/16 VXL motors yet? They are quite small. Even two might be overtaxed running in snow (lots of drag) IMO. I guess it depends on how low you gear it. Will the VXL motors even bolt up?

But, a couple CC4600 systems should work nicely on 2s or 3s.
